Maddie Knisley (born September 9, 2003) is an American professional wrestler, currently signed to WWE performing for the NXT (WWE brand) brand under the ring name Thea Hail. She previously wrestled on the independent circuit and made appearances for All Elite Wrestling (AEW) under the ring name Nikita Knight.

Professional wrestling career

All Elite Wrestling (2021)

Knisley made two appearances for All Elite Wrestling (AEW) on AEW Dark, losing to Thunder Rosa and Julia Hart (wrestler).[1][2]

WWE (2022-present)

On March 17, 2022, it was announced that Knisley had signed to WWE and would be reporting to the WWE Performance Center.[3] She made her debut on the April 8 episode of the NXT Level Up under the ring name Thea Hail, losing to Ivy Nile. On the May 31 episode of NXT, Hail graduated from college and chose to study in Andre Chase University.[4][5] Hail would start appearing regularly with Chase U members Andre Chase and Bodhi Hayward, going on a winning streak on NXT Level Up. On the August 9 episode of NXT, Hail made her televised in-ring debut against Arianna Grace in a losing effort.[6][7][8][9][10] On the November 1 episode of NXT, Duke Hudson joined Chase U replacing Bodhi Hayward and helped Chase and Hail after the former was attacked by Charlie Dempsey.[11]
